Abstract
Storage-stable, silane-modified core-shell copolymers are provided comprising a shell-forming copolymer I of
a) from 70 to 95% by weight, based on the overall weight of the shell, of acrylic and/or methacrylic C1 - to C10 -alkyl esters of which from 20 to 80% by weight have a water solubility of not more than 2 g/l and from 80 to 20% by weight, based in each case on the comonomers a), have a water solubility of at least 10 g/l, and
b) from 5 to 30% by weight, based on the overall weight of the shell, of one or more ethylenically unsaturated, functional and water-soluble monomers including a proportion of from 25 to 100% by weight, based on the comonomers b), of unsaturated carboxylic acids, and a core-forming copolymer II of one or more monomers c) from the group of the vinyl esters, monoolefinically unsaturated mono- or dicarboxylic esters, vinylaromatic compounds, olefins, 1,3-dienes and vinyl halides,
wherein the shell contains no silane compounds and the core comprises one or more silane compounds d) from the group of the mercaptosilanes alone or in combination with olefinically unsaturated, hydrolyzable silicon compounds.

7. A process for preparing storage-stable, silane-modified core-shell copolymer dispersions and powders by free-radical emulsion polymerization of a comonomer mixture I comprising
a) from 70 to 95% by weight, based on the overall weight of the comonomer mixture I, of acrylic and/or methacrylic C1 - to C10 -alkyl esters of which from 20 to 80% by weight have a water solubility of not more than 2 g/l and from 80 to 20% by weight, based in each case on the comonomers a), have a water solubility of at least 10 g/l, and b) from 5 to 30% by weight, based on the overall weight of the comonomer mixture I, of one or more ethylenically unsaturated, functional and water-soluble monomers including a proportion of from 25 to 100% by weight, based on the comonomers b), of unsaturated carboxylic acids, and the comonomer mixture I is introduced into a reactor together with water and emulsifier at a pH of from 2 to 5, polymerization is started by adding an initiator at a temperature of from 40° - C. to 90°
C. and, at a conversion of at least 40% of the comonomer mixture I, a comonomer mixture II comprising one or more monomers c) selected from the group consisting of the vinyl esters, monoolefinically unsaturated mono- or dicarboxylic esters, vinylaromatic compounds, olefins, 1,3-dienes and vinyl halides is metered in, alone or with further emulsifier and initiator, and the resulting copolymer dispersion is dried if desired, wherein the comonomer mixture I contains no silane compounds and the comonomer mixture II comprises one or more silane compounds d) from the group of the mercaptosilanes alone or in combination with one or more olefinically unsaturated, hydrolyzable silicon compounds.
